Summary
Bucket type muzzle for a horse. Stitched leather with copper rivets and a strap to go over the horse's head with punched holes. Muzzle allows horse to drink but not eat.
Provenance
An item from the Llanerchaeron collection, left to the National Trust in the will of John Powell Ponsonby Lewes in 1989
